AdvertisementDr Hadgawar Smarak Society Vs CIT (Exemptions) (ITAT Delhi) Delhi ITAT: Hindu Religious Activities Alone Cannot Deny 12AB/80G Approval; Activities for Public at Large Are Charitable – 5% Religious Expenditure Permitted The Delhi ITAT set aside the CIT(E)’s orders rejecting/curtailing the Society’s registration under section 12AB and approval under section 80G on the ground that its activities were predominantly religious.
The CIT(E) had treated the Society as a religious entity and denied section 80G approval, relying upon Upper Ganges Sugar Mills Ltd. v. CIT.
